/*
10
 * Blast memory layout:
11
 *	CS0: FE000000 -> FFFFFFFF (Flash)
12
 *	CS1: FC000000 -> FCFFFFFF (DSP hpi)
13
 *	CS2: 00000000 -> 03FFFFFF (60x sdram)
14
 *	CS3: 04000000 -> 04FFFFFF (FPGA)
15
 *	CS4: 05000000 -> 06FFFFFF (local bus sdram)
16
 *	CS5: 07000000 -> 070FFFFF (eeprom - not populated)
17
 *	CS6: E0000000 -> E0FFFFFF (FPGA)
18
 *
19
 * Main Board memory lay out:
20
 *	CS0: FE000000 -> FEFFFFFF (16 M FLASH)
21
 *	CS1: FC000000 -> FCFFFFFF (16 M DSP1)
22
 *	CS2: 00000000 -> 03FFFFFF (64 M SDRAM)
23
 *	CS3: 04000000 -> 04FFFFFF (16M DSP2)
24
 *	CS4: 05000000 -> 06FFFFFF (32 M Local SDRAM)
25
 *	CS5: 07000000 -> 070FFFFF (eeprom - not populated)
26
 *	CS6: E0000000 -> E0FFFFFF (16 M FPGA)
27
 *
28
 *	CS2, CS3, CS4, (and CS5) are covered by DBAT 0,  CS0 and CS1 by DBAT 3, CS6 by DBAT 2
29
 */
